The crew of a Manchester aircraft were engaged in a transit flight with a crew of 6 and a servicing party of 4 returning to base after attending to a Manchester that had landed at Haverigg Airfield, Cumberland, when they crashed while in the landing circuit near Lincoln at Waddington near South Hykeham, England.

Killed includes Clements: AC1 Reginald Boyd RAF KIA Crosby Cemetery Scunthorpe Sec. C.F. Grave 369. LAC Leslie Wilfred Carter RAF KIA St. Swithin's Cemetery Lincoln Sec. R. Grave 329. Sergeant John Russell Clements RCAF J/5313 KIA St. Michael Churchyard Waddington. Flying Officer Ernest Edwin Gordon Crump RAF pilot KIA St. Michael Churchyard. AC2 James William Grace RAF KIA St. Michael Churchyard. AC2 Jack Lister RAF KIA Newport Cemetery Lincoln Sec. G. Grave 313 South. Sergeant Norman Alan Mathison RAF KIA Northallerton Cemetery Grave 4393. LAC John Frederick Riding RAF KIA Stretford Cemetery Sec. C.L. Grave 127. Pilot Officer John Patrick Anthony Sawyer RCAF J/5135 pilot KIA Beaconsfield Cemetery, Buckinghamshire Grave 1846. LAC Harold Francis Winter RAF KIA Dewsbury Cemetery Cons. Sec. P. Grave 428.
